Ethnic Distribution of Miltenberger
According to the US Census, the Miltenberger surname is distributed across the following ethnic groups. This data reflects self-reported ethnicity among 1,446 Americans with the Miltenberger last name.
| Ethnicity | Percentage |
|---|---|
| White | 95.3% |
| Black | 1.04% |
| Hispanic | 1.31% |
| Asian/Pacific Islander | 0.35% |
| Native American | 1.04% |
| Two or More Races | 0.97% |
